High school teachers fail to agree on length of strike action

A new meeting has been scheduled for Thursday to try and reach a common position on the strike action.

During Tuesday’s meeting, SYRIZA-affiliated group representatives proposed that the union go ahead with repeated 48-hour strikes, while ANTARSIA representatives wanted an indefinite strike. The New Democracy party-affiliated group was in favour of a single 48-hour strike, as was the Communist Party of Greece (KKE)-affiliated group. The PASOK-affiliated group proposed two 48-hour strikes.

The associations of high school teachers (ELME) are to convene in the first week of September, while the final decision is to be taken just one day before schools open, on September 10.

It is highly likely that any strike action will be called for the second week of the new school year, after September 16.
